How does it work
The motor is the most important part of a robot vacuum, as it creates suction to draw dirt and debris in the vacuum bag. Some robot cleaners come with combination of roller brushes, a side brush and mops to agitate and raise particles into the suction. Some robotic cleaners feature smart features like the ability to return to the dock when it is charged and full. Certain models have voice activation and smart home integration. You can control the machine with the app on your smartphone or your personal assistant.
Sensors help robots navigate their surroundings by avoiding obstacles and tense corners. Common sensors include obstacle and cliff sensors that prevent the robot from falling off stairs or getting stuck underneath furniture. Certain robots also have dirt sensors which alert you when they are dirty and require to be cleaned. Cleaning time
The time needed to clean a space can also be affected by the number of obstacles the robot faces. The time it takes to clean a room can also be affected by how many obstacles the robot encounters when it needs to push furniture, stay clear of shoes and socks, or navigate through messy rooms.
The majority of robotic vacuum and mop systems can sense carpets and use the right power settings, however they can leave some dirt behind, particularly on shag or high-pile rug. Certain models require more power to maneuver through carpets that are very thick and drain batteries faster.
Other factors can affect a robot's performance, including the condition of its equipment and how often it needs to be serviced. A side brush that is tangled could stop the robot from performing its job, and a full or dirty filter can cause it to overheat or disconnect from the internet.

We recommend that you give the floor a once-over yourself before you run your robot's cleaner. This will ensure that any difficult or sticky spills are cleaned before the robot arrives. It is also essential to clean up any small or tiniest items prior to a mopping session so that the robot doesn't get tangled or swept into them.

It's important to avoid putting any other chemicals, like floor cleaner or laundry detergent or floor cleaner, into your robot mop's water tank unless the manufacturer specifies it's okay. This can damage internal components and void the warranty.
